Basketball fans and gamers are gearing up for some international competition.

2K Sports and the Turkish Airlines Euroleague signed an exclusive partnership earlier this summer, which will add 14 European teams to the 2K Sports series. NBA 2K14, which will be released Oct. 2, will be the first video game to feature teams from the Euroleague.

"We're absolutely delighted to be able to welcome top Euroleague teams into the NBA 2K series," said Jason Argent, senior vice president of sports operations for 2K Sports.  "European basketball has an incredibly passionate following, and we're all excited to give fans the opportunity to take on Europe's best in NBA 2K14."

Adding international teams to the game is a new idea but is almost certainly going to globalize the 2K Sports brand even further by catering and expanding to the international market. The 14 teams will be representing 8 European countries. NBA 2K14 will be released on Microsoft Windows, Xbox 360, Playstation 3, Playstation 4, and Xbox One. It will be the first video game of the series to be released on Playstation 4 and Xbox One, neither of which has been released yet.

2KSports will seek to address gameplay concerns, and according to a tweet by 2KSport's Twitter account, the new game will introduce the ability to block dunks. This was an important complaint following the release of NBA 2K13 a year ago.

LeBron James is the cover athlete for this year's game, and those who preorder the game will receive the "King James Bonus Pack." According to 2Ksports.com, the pack includes four extra features, including extra content for the new "Path to Greatness" mode.
